I'm looking for an effective mass storage device to back up my 70MB winchester. Since my system is a DEC Rainbow, which is compatible with almost nothing, I can't use most of the popular IBM PC oriented options. About the only standard part of my system is the disk controller, which can run two ST412/ST506 compatible drives. Since I'm only using one drive, the ideal solution would be a tape cartridge drive that looks like an ST412/ST506 disk drive. A disk cartridge drive would be OK too, except that the ones I've seen only hold 5MB, and the cartridges cost $100 apiece -- which means $1400 in media for just one full backup.
